Most of the time, there is a correlation between the SP500 index and it's volatility. As you can see in the chart, a trend reversal occured in SP500 almost everytime VIX dipped.
Now, SP500 is at a major resistance and the VIX is at the lowest level of the recent time. It wouldn't be surprising to see a reversal for SP500 at this point.
Where can be a recovery level if a reversal occurs now? There are two strong support levels below the price, thinking the SP500 is greatly sensitive to weekly averages. I think recovery point will be either one of the below.

- Where the 20-weekly MA (thin one) and 0.382 of the last impulse wave coincides
- The area between the 50-weekly MA (thick one) and 0.618 of the last impulse wave.
